TRIUMPH OF THE YUPPIES: America, the Eighties, and the Creation of an Unequal Nation
The first history of the Yuppie phenomenon, chronicling the roots, rise, triumph, and (seeming) fall of the young urban professionals who radically altered American life between 1980 and 1987.
